Skip to content
This repository was archived by the owner on Oct 6, 2025. It is now read-only.

Commit 11c00ab

Browse files
committed
now using version specific fhir profile urls
In order to allow for multiple versions of the same process, we need to specify version specific profiles in our ActivityDefinition authorization extensions and BPMN models. Added `|0.4.0` to the canonical profile urls.
1 parent d448905 commit 11c00ab

11 files changed

Lines changed: 11 additions & 11 deletions

codex-process-data-transfer/src/main/resources/bpe/send.bpmn

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,7 @@
2222
<camunda:inputOutput>
2323
<camunda:inputParameter name="instantiatesUri">http://www.netzwerk-universitaetsmedizin.de/bpe/Process/dataTranslate/0.4.0</camunda:inputParameter>
2424
<camunda:inputParameter name="messageName">startDataTranslate</camunda:inputParameter>
25-
<camunda:inputParameter name="profile">http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-translate</camunda:inputParameter>
25+
<camunda:inputParameter name="profile">http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-translate|0.4.0</camunda:inputParameter>
2626
</camunda:inputOutput>
2727
</bpmn:extensionElements>
2828
<bpmn:incoming>Flow_109e2pt</bpmn:incoming>

codex-process-data-transfer/src/main/resources/bpe/translate.bpmn

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,7 @@
2626
<camunda:inputOutput>
2727
<camunda:inputParameter name="instantiatesUri">http://www.netzwerk-universitaetsmedizin.de/bpe/Process/dataReceive/0.4.0</camunda:inputParameter>
2828
<camunda:inputParameter name="messageName">startDataReceive</camunda:inputParameter>
29-
<camunda:inputParameter name="profile">http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-receive</camunda:inputParameter>
29+
<camunda:inputParameter name="profile">http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-receive|0.4.0</camunda:inputParameter>
3030
</camunda:inputOutput>
3131
</bpmn:extensionElements>
3232
<bpmn:incoming>Flow_1c2ibtj</bpmn:incoming>

codex-process-data-transfer/src/main/resources/bpe/trigger.bpmn

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@
1010
<camunda:inputOutput>
1111
<camunda:inputParameter name="instantiatesUri">http://www.netzwerk-universitaetsmedizin.de/bpe/Process/dataSend/0.4.0</camunda:inputParameter>
1212
<camunda:inputParameter name="messageName">startDataSend</camunda:inputParameter>
13-
<camunda:inputParameter name="profile">http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-send</camunda:inputParameter>
13+
<camunda:inputParameter name="profile">http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-send|0.4.0</camunda:inputParameter>
1414
</camunda:inputOutput>
1515
<camunda:properties>
1616
<camunda:property name="dsf.end.listener" value="false" />

codex-process-data-transfer/src/main/resources/fhir/ActivityDefinition/num-codex-data-receive.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@
1212
</extension>
1313
<extension url="task-profile">
1414
<valueCanonical
15-
value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-receive" />
15+
value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-receive|${version}" />
1616
</extension>
1717
<extension url="requester">
1818
<valueCoding>

codex-process-data-transfer/src/main/resources/fhir/ActivityDefinition/num-codex-data-send.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@
1212
</extension>
1313
<extension url="task-profile">
1414
<valueCanonical
15-
value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-send" />
15+
value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-send|${version}" />
1616
</extension>
1717
<extension url="requester">
1818
<valueCoding>

codex-process-data-transfer/src/main/resources/fhir/ActivityDefinition/num-codex-data-translate.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@
1212
</extension>
1313
<extension url="task-profile">
1414
<valueCanonical
15-
value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-translate" />
15+
value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-translate|${version}" />
1616
</extension>
1717
<extension url="requester">
1818
<valueCoding>

codex-process-data-transfer/src/main/resources/fhir/ActivityDefinition/num-codex-data-trigger.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@
1212
</extension>
1313
<extension url="task-profile">
1414
<valueCanonical
15-
value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-trigger" />
15+
value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-trigger|${version}" />
1616
</extension>
1717
<extension url="requester">
1818
<valueCoding>

codex-process-data-transfer/src/test/resources/fhir/Task/TaskStartDataSendWithAbsoluteReference.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
<Task xmlns="http://hl7.org/fhir">
22
<meta>
3-
<profile value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-send"/>
3+
<profile value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-send|0.4.0"/>
44
</meta>
55
<instantiatesUri value="http://www.netzwerk-universitaetsmedizin.de/bpe/Process/dataSend/0.4.0"/>
66
<status value="requested"/>

codex-process-data-transfer/src/test/resources/fhir/Task/TaskStartDataSendWithIdentifierReference.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
<Task xmlns="http://hl7.org/fhir">
22
<meta>
3-
<profile value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-send"/>
3+
<profile value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-send|0.4.0"/>
44
</meta>
55
<instantiatesUri value="http://www.netzwerk-universitaetsmedizin.de/bpe/Process/dataSend/0.4.0"/>
66
<status value="requested"/>

codex-process-data-transfer/src/test/resources/fhir/Task/TaskStartDataTrigger.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
<Task xmlns="http://hl7.org/fhir">
22
<meta>
3-
<profile value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-trigger"/>
3+
<profile value="http://www.netzwerk-universitaetsmedizin.de/fhir/StructureDefinition/task-start-data-trigger|0.4.0"/>
44
</meta>
55
<instantiatesUri value="http://www.netzwerk-universitaetsmedizin.de/bpe/Process/dataTrigger/0.4.0"/>
66
<status value="requested"/>

0 commit comments

Comments
 (0)